آموزش [جدید] برنامه نویسی پایتون برای مبتدیان - آخرین آپدیت

دانلود [NEW] Python Programming for Beginners

نکته: ممکن هست محتوای این صفحه بروز نباشد ولی دانلود دوره آخرین آپدیت می باشد.
نمونه ویدیوها:
توضیحات دوره:

یادگیری پایتون به روش آسان: ویدئوهای انیمیشنی سرگرم‌کننده و چالش‌های برنامه‌نویسی پیشرونده

با کدنویسی ساده پایتون، برنامه‌هایی با استفاده از متغیرها، حلقه‌ها و توابع بسازید.

مفاهیم پایه پایتون را از طریق درس‌های ویدیویی سرگرم‌کننده و انیمیشنی برای یادگیری آسان درک کنید.

از شرط‌ها و رشته‌ها برای ساخت اسکریپت‌های خلاقانه پایتون استفاده کنید.

چالش‌های کدنویسی مناسب مبتدیان را برای تقویت مهارت‌های حل مسئله حل کنید.

با لیست‌ها و دیکشنری‌های پایتون پروژه‌های کوچک بسازید تا دانش خود را به کار ببرید.

پیش‌نیازها:

بدون نیاز به تجربه کدنویسی – فقط یک کامپیوتر و جرقه هیجان برای شروع کدنویسی با پایتون کافیست!

"برنامه‌نویسی پایتون برای مبتدیان": دروازه سریع شما به دنیای پایتون

"برنامه‌نویسی پایتون برای مبتدیان" دروازه سریع شما به دنیای برنامه‌نویسی با پایتون، یکی از قدرتمندترین، پرکاربردترین و همه‌کاره‌ترین زبان‌های صنعت فناوری است. 

این دوره که به طور خاص برای مبتدیان مطلق طراحی شده است، هیچ تجربه برنامه‌نویسی قبلی نیاز ندارد – فقط اشتیاق برای شروع و یادگیری. 

شما مفاهیم بنیادی پایتون مانند متغیرها، انواع داده، ساختارهای کنترلی، حلقه‌ها و توابع را به صورت تخصصی فرا خواهید گرفت، که همگی از طریق سینتکس واضح و قدرتمند پایتون ارائه می‌شوند – نقطه شروع ایده‌آلی برای کدنویسان جدید.

چه چیزی این دوره را متمایز می‌کند؟

این دوره فقط درباره مبانی نیست – این درباره تحول است.

انیمیشن‌های زنده مفاهیم را زنده می‌کنند و یادگیری را سریع‌تر، جذاب‌تر و به طور کامل سرگرم‌کننده می‌سازند. 

سپس شما وارد تمرین‌های کدنویسی عملی در مرورگر می‌شوید و مسائل LEETCODE منتخب را حل می‌کنید، از مبانی ساده به حل چالش‌های دنیای واقعی پیش می‌روید که توانایی حل مسئله شما را تیزتر می‌کند.

این تمرین‌های LeetCode مبتنی بر مرورگر به شما امکان کدنویسی فوری را می‌دهند – بدون نیاز به نصب و راه‌اندازی، فقط نتایج.

این تمرین‌ها شما را از یک تازه‌کار به یک کدنویس قادر به مدیریت سناریوهای پیچیده تبدیل می‌کنند و مهارت‌های حل مسئله شما را با هر قدم تقویت می‌کنند. 

این ترکیب قدرتمند از درس‌های انیمیشنی و تمرین عملی تضمین می‌کند که شما فقط پایتون را یاد نمی‌گیرید – بلکه تفکر مانند یک برنامه‌نویس را یاد می‌گیرید.

در پایان، شما با یک پایه پایتون قوی و تجربه عملی که شما را متمایز می‌کند، مجهز خواهید شد. 

چه در حال شروع یک حرفه فناوری، ساخت پروژه‌های شخصی، یا صرفاً کنجکاوی در مورد کدنویسی باشید، این دوره بدون حاشیه هر آنچه را که نیاز داریدبه سرعت – ارائه می‌دهد. 

لحظه خود را غنیمت بشمارید – با تخصص پایتون امروز، جهان امکانات کدنویسی را باز کنید!


سرفصل ها و درس ها

مقدمه Introduction

  • خوش آمدید و آنچه یاد خواهید گرفت Welcome & What You’ll Learn

  • سلام دنیا! (اولین کد پایتون شما) Hello World! (Your First Python Code)

  • سلام دنیا! Hello World!

متغیرها و انواع داده Variables & Data Types

  • مقدمه ای بر متغیرها Introduction to Variables

  • متغیرها Variables

  • ادامه متغیرها Variables Continued

  • تغییر مجدد مقادیر متغیر Reassignment of Variable Values

  • انواع داده Data Types

  • انواع داده (یادداشت ها) Data Types (Notes)

  • انواع داده Data Types

  • ورودی Input

  • ورودی Input

  • تعویض متغیرها - تخصیص Swap Variables - Assignment

  • تعویض متغیرها Swap Variables

  • تعویض متغیرها - راه حل Swap Variables - Solution

عملگرها Operators

  • عملگرهای ریاضی Math Operators

  • عملگرهای ریاضی (یادداشت ها) Math Operators (Notes)

  • عملگرهای ریاضی Math Operators

  • مستطیل - تخصیص Rectangle - Assignment

  • مستطیل Rectangle

  • مستطیل - راه حل Rectangle - Solution

  • عملگرهای مقایسه ای Comparison Operators

  • عملگرهای مقایسه ای (یادداشت ها) Comparison Operators (Notes)

  • عملگرهای مقایسه ای Comparison Operators

  • عملگرهای منطقی Logical Operators

  • عملگرهای منطقی (یادداشت ها) Logical Operators (Notes)

  • عملگرهای منطقی Logical Operators

رشته ها Strings

  • رشته: مقدمه String: Intro

  • رشته: مقدمه (یادداشت ها) String: Intro (Notes)

  • رشته: مقدمه (تمرین) String: Intro (Exercise)

  • رشته: نقل قول ها String: Quotes

  • رشته: نقل قول ها String: Quotes

  • رشته: دنباله های گریز String: Escape Sequences

  • رشته: دنباله های گریز String: Escape Sequences

  • رشته: الحاق String: Concatenation

  • رشته: الحاق String: Concatenation

  • رشته: متدها String: Methods

  • رشته: متدها (یادداشت ها) String: Methods (Notes)

  • رشته: متدها String: Methods

  • رشته های F F-Strings

  • رشته های F (یادداشت ها) F-Strings (Notes)

  • رشته های F F-Strings

دستورات شرطی (if, elif, else) Conditional Statements (if, elif, else)

  • دستورات If - مقدمه If Statements - Intro

  • دستورات If (یادداشت ها) If Statements (Notes)

  • ممیز Grader

  • درک درستی Understanding Truthiness

  • درستی (یادداشت ها) Truthiness (Notes)

  • درستی Truthiness

حلقه ها Loops

  • حلقه های While - مقدمه While Loops - Intro

  • حلقه های While - مقدمه While Loops - Intro

  • حلقه های For - مبتنی بر Range For Loops - Range Based

  • حلقه های For - مبتنی بر Range For Loops - Range Based

  • حلقه های For - راه حل تمرین مبتنی بر Range For Loops - Range Based Exercise Solution

  • حلقه های تودرتو Nested Loops

  • حلقه های تودرتو (یادداشت ها) Nested Loops (Notes)

  • حلقه های تودرتو Nested Loops

  • پیمایش مجموعه ها Iterating Over Collections

  • پیمایش مجموعه ها (یادداشت ها) Iterating Over Collections (Notes)

  • حلقه های While در مقابل For While vs For Loops

توابع Functions

  • تابع: مقدمه Function: Introduction

  • تابع: پارامترها Function: Parameters

  • تابع: محاسبات مستطیل - تخصیص Function: Rectangle Calculations - Assignment

  • تابع: محاسبات مستطیل Function: Rectangle Calculations

  • تابع: محاسبات مستطیل - راه حل Function: Rectangle Calculations - Solution

  • دامنه متغیر Variable Scope

ساختارهای داده Data Structures

  • لیست ها: ایندکسینگ و برش Lists: Indexing & Slicing

  • لیست ها: تغییر عناصر Lists: Modifying Elements

  • لیست ها (یادداشت ها) Lists (Notes)

  • مجموعه ها Sets

  • مجموعه ها (یادداشت ها) Sets (Notes)

  • تاپل ها Tuples

  • تاپل ها (یادداشت ها) Tuples (Notes)

  • دیکشنری ها Dictionaries

  • دیکشنری ها (یادداشت ها) Dictionaries (Notes)

چالش های کدنویسی - گام های اولیه Coding Challenges - First Steps

  • زوج یا فرد Even or Odd

  • زوج یا فرد Even or Odd

  • بزرگترین از دو عدد Max of Two

  • بزرگترین از دو عدد Max of Two

  • مجموع آرایه Sum Array

  • مجموع آرایه Sum Array

  • تکرار یک کلمه Repeat a Word

  • تکرار یک کلمه Repeat a Word

  • شمارش حرف 'a' Count the Letter 'a'

  • شمارش حرف 'a' Count the Letter 'a'

  • جمع ارقام در یک رشته Add Digits in a String

  • جمع ارقام در یک رشته Add Digits in a String

  • شمارش زوج ها Count Evens

  • شمارش زوج ها Count Evens

چالش های کدنویسی - گام های بعدی Coding Challenges - Moving Forward

  • آیا مصوت است؟ Is It a Vowel?

  • رشته معکوس Reverse String

  • حذف مصوت ها از یک رشته Remove Vowels from a String

  • جایگزینی فاصله ها با خط تیره Replace Spaces with Hyphens

  • مبدل دما Temperature Converter

  • دومین عدد بزرگ Second Largest Number

  • آیا لیست صعودی است؟ Is List Ascending?

  • اولین عدد تکراری (حلقه های تودرتو) First Repeating Number (Nested Loops)

  • اولین عدد تکراری (مجموعه) First Repeating Number (Set)

  • یافتن تکراری ها Find Duplicates

  • رایج ترین مقدار Most Common Value

چالش های کدنویسی - کسب مهارت Coding Challenges - Gaining Skills

  • آنگرام معتبر (LeetCode) Valid Anagram (LeetCode)

  • حذف تکراری های مجاور (LeetCode) Remove Adjacent Duplicates (LeetCode)

  • چرخش لیست (LeetCode) Rotate List (LeetCode)

  • عدد گمشده (LeetCode) Missing Number (LeetCode)

  • زیردنباله است (LeetCode) Is Subsequence (LeetCode)

  • اولین کاراکتر منحصر به فرد در رشته (LeetCode) First Unique Character in String (LeetCode)

  • حداکثر سود (LeetCode) Max Profit (LeetCode)

  • فشرده سازی رشته (LeetCode) String Compression (LeetCode)

  • دو تا (LeetCode) Two Sum (LeetCode)

  • پرانتزهای معتبر (LeetCode) Valid Parentheses (LeetCode)

  • عنصر اکثریت (LeetCode) Majority Element (LeetCode)

  • جمع ارقام (LeetCode) Add Digits (LeetCode)

  • چک کننده پانگرام (LeetCode) Pangram Checker (LeetCode)

  • پیشوند مشترک طولانی (LeetCode) Longest Common Prefix (LeetCode)

  • اشتراک دو آرایه (LeetCode) Intersection of Two Arrays (LeetCode)

  • زیررشته پالیندروم طولانی (LeetCode) Longest Palindromic Substring (LeetCode)

  • دنباله متوالی طولانی (LeetCode) Longest Consecutive Sequence (LeetCode)

  • گروه آنگرام ها (LeetCode) Group Anagrams (LeetCode)

  • مجموع زیرآرایه برابر K (LeetCode) Subarray Sum Equals K (LeetCode)

نمایش نظرات

آموزش [جدید] برنامه نویسی پایتون برای مبتدیان
جزییات دوره
4 hours
44
Udemy (یودمی) Udemy (یودمی)
(آخرین آپدیت)
293
4.6 از 5
ندارد
دارد
دارد
Scott Barrett
جهت دریافت آخرین اخبار و آپدیت ها در کانال تلگرام عضو شوید.

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ar

Scott Barrett Scott Barrett

توسعه دهنده و مدرس اصلی